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Aidan
United KingdomThe hot water occasionally cut out- but the shower was still nice. No sign outside made it slightly tricky to find (it’s Casa del Pozo)- but again, no big deal!
Beautiful old building in a great location for exploring Santa Marta. Comfortable bed and great AC in the room. Very friendly staff who let us store our bags there for free whilst we did the Lost City trek. Good breakfast - juice, coffee, fruit, granola, eggs and arepas.

Reviewed: 21 January 2024
Alexandra
GermanyCan be noisy at night, with the music from bars and discos nearby. The lounges at the pool are hard as the wood they are made from. The practically non-existent light in the bathroom. Great for ignoring wrinkles, but try to paint one’s face 😉
The colonial house is said to be 300 years old, and a gem inside. Beautifully decorated, the rooms/suites with high ceilings, comfortable bed, enough space. Great pool in the patio to unwind and cool down. Very good breakfast and super friendly staff.
